> Hi Aaron
>
> we compute the warp and save it in the mri/transforms/talairach.m3z, but
> don't apply it (so don't require an extra resampling). I know we have some
> tools around to convert to ANTS format, but I'm not sure about fnirt. I'll
> cc MJ who may know (hi MJ!)
